The effect of changes in iron-endpoint during Peirce–Smith convertingon PGE-containing nickel converter matte mineralization
PGE-containing nickel-copper converter matte is blown to an iron-endpoint during Peirce–Smith conversion. The matte is granulated after conversion and the process can be described as fast cooling.
